About The Position

The Attorney General’s Office (AGO) seeks a highly motivated individual to support initiatives and matters related to Diversity, Equity, Inclusion (DEI) and the communities we serve. The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ion Program Coordinator will collaborate closely with the Chief of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ion to strategically support and advance the office’s DEI initiatives. This role involves assisting in the execution and coordination of key programs, promoting an inclusive workplace culture, and furthering the organization’s DEI objectives.

Responsibilities

  • Create and oversee large-scale internal programs and events, such as mentorship initiatives, culture-building activities and book clubs, workshops, and other employee engagement efforts.
  • Assist in the development and coordination of Employee Resource Groups (ERGs).
  • Conduct comprehensive research on DEI topics, emerging trends, and best practices to inform the development of internal programs and strategic decision-making.
  • Oversee office-wide DEI communications such as the weekly newsletter and internal websites.
  • Collaborate with the team to manage the day-to-day operations of programs and projects that provide ongoing learning and educational opportunities within the office.
